Microneedling, also known as collagen induction therapy, is a minimally invasive cosmetic procedure that has gained popularity for its effectiveness in treating various skin concerns, including scars. The process involves the use of a device with fine needles to create tiny punctures in the skin. These micro-injuries stimulate the body's natural healing process, which in turn boosts collagen and elastin production.
For scars, microneedling can significantly improve their appearance by promoting skin regeneration. The increased collagen production helps to fill in the depressed areas of the scar, making it less noticeable. Additionally, the procedure can help to break down the fibrous tissue that often contributes to the raised appearance of scars, such as those caused by acne or surgery.
The benefits of microneedling for scars are not limited to physical improvement. The procedure can also enhance the overall texture and tone of the skin, providing a more uniform appearance. While results may vary depending on the severity and type of scar, multiple sessions are typically recommended for optimal outcomes.
It's important to note that microneedling is generally safe, but like any medical procedure, it carries some risks. Potential side effects include temporary redness, swelling, and discomfort. Understanding Microneedling: A Comprehensive Approach to Scar Reduction
Microneedling, also known as collagen induction therapy, has emerged as a highly effective treatment for reducing the appearance of various types of scars, including acne scars. This procedure involves the use of a device with tiny needles that create controlled micro-injuries to the skin. These micro-injuries stimulate the body's natural healing process, leading to the production of new collagen and elastin, which are essential for skin rejuvenation.
Mechanism of Action
The primary mechanism behind microneedling's effectiveness lies in its ability to induce collagen production. When the micro-needles penetrate the skin, they trigger a wound-healing response. This response includes the release of growth factors and cytokines, which encourage the proliferation of fibroblasts. Fibroblasts are the cells responsible for producing collagen and elastin, two proteins that provide skin with its strength and elasticity. Over time, this increased collagen production helps to fill in the depressed areas of scars, making them less noticeable.
Types of Scars Treated
Microneedling is particularly effective for treating atrophic scars, which are commonly associated with acne. Atrophic scars are characterized by a loss of tissue, resulting in a depressed appearance. The procedure can also be beneficial for hypertrophic and keloid scars, although these types of scars may require additional treatments such as corticosteroid injections or laser therapy.
Procedure and Recovery
The microneedling procedure itself is relatively quick and straightforward. After cleansing the skin, a topical numbing cream is applied to minimize discomfort. The microneedling device is then moved across the treatment area, creating tiny punctures in the skin. The entire process typically takes about 30 minutes to an hour, depending on the size of the area being treated.
Following the procedure, patients may experience mild redness and swelling, similar to a sunburn. These side effects usually subside within a few hours to a couple of days. It is important to follow post-treatment care instructions, which may include avoiding direct sun exposure, using gentle skincare products, and applying a soothing moisturizer.
Results and Maintenance
The results of microneedling are gradual and become more apparent over several weeks to months. Most patients require a series of 3 to 6 sessions, spaced 4 to 6 weeks apart, to achieve optimal results. The longevity of the results can vary depending on individual factors such as skin type and the severity of the scars. To maintain the benefits, some patients may choose to undergo maintenance treatments every 6 to 12 months.
